    Hey guys, I am new to relic hunting. Someone is trying to sell me a Tank Assault 100 Engagement badge. I understand that these are extremely rare and valuable. He says he received it from a vet in Holland, he seems honest and has a large collection. It is in BRUTAL shape. I noticed that the 25-50-100 Engagement badges show a Panzer crushing sticks rather than grass, the back seems to have some sort of a mark. I am a rookie and have no real knowledge, please shed some light! I assume its not real but I have to check with the pros! Check it out!

    That is about as fake as you are ever likely to find. A very poor representation of what is a two piece and generally well made award.

    You will note the two pieces have been cast and moulded to give the impression but fool no-one. Everything is wrong with this badge.
